Output 5e7cf8e33906106c16fc07208ac20b909735bb7941fe2185c162d1bb35b72196:1

value
443708000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aecb228406534b5a5bd23da809a85fc3c615fcf4 OP_EQUAL
address
3HdEqyeSt8wXjS7ckT7ZNhUz3oX2LVcK1Z
transaction
5e7cf8e33906106c16fc07208ac20b909735bb7941fe2185c162d1bb35b72196
confirmations
172902
spent
true